如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

《Java编程思想读书报告》:深入理解Java编程的精髓

《Java编程思想读书报告》:深入理解Java编程的精髓

Java编程思想是一本深入浅出的Java编程教材,作者Bruce Eckel通过丰富的示例和详尽的解释,帮助读者掌握Java语言的核心概念和编程技巧。以下是关于《Java编程思想读书报告》的详细介绍和相关应用。

书籍概述

《Java编程思想》是一本经典的Java教材,适用于初学者和有一定编程基础的读者。书中不仅涵盖了Java语言的基础语法,还深入探讨了面向对象编程(OOP)、异常处理、并发编程、I/O系统等高级主题。通过阅读这本书,读者可以系统地学习Java编程的思想和方法。

读书报告内容

  1. 基础语法与概念

    • 书中从最基本的Java语法开始,逐步引导读者理解变量、数据类型、运算符、控制流等基础知识。通过大量的代码示例,读者可以快速上手并实践。
  2. 面向对象编程(OOP)

    • OOP是Java编程的核心,书中详细讲解了类与对象、继承、多态、接口等概念。通过实际案例,读者可以理解如何利用OOP来设计和实现复杂的软件系统。
  3. 异常处理

    • 异常处理是编写健壮代码的重要环节。书中介绍了Java的异常机制,如何捕获和处理异常,以及自定义异常的创建。
  4. 并发编程

    • 随着多核处理器的普及,并发编程变得越来越重要。书中详细讲解了Java的并发模型,包括线程、锁、并发集合等内容。
  5. I/O系统

    • I/O操作是程序与外部世界交互的桥梁。书中介绍了Java的I/O流、文件操作、网络编程等内容,帮助读者理解如何进行高效的I/O操作。

相关应用

  1. 企业级应用开发

    • Java广泛应用于企业级应用开发,如ERP系统、CRM系统等。通过学习《Java编程思想》,开发者可以更好地理解和应用Java EE(Enterprise Edition)技术。
  2. Web开发

    • Java的Servlet、JSP、Spring框架等都是Web开发的核心技术。书中虽然没有直接涉及这些框架,但其所讲解的Java基础和OOP思想为学习这些框架打下了坚实的基础。
  3. 移动应用开发

    • Android开发是Java的一个重要应用领域。书中所讲的Java核心知识对于理解Android的开发模式和API非常有帮助。
  4. 大数据处理

    • Java在Hadoop、Spark等大数据处理框架中扮演着重要角色。理解Java的并发编程和I/O系统对于处理大数据非常关键。
  5. 游戏开发

    • 虽然Java不是游戏开发的主流语言,但一些游戏引擎如libGDX使用Java进行开发。书中关于图形编程和并发的部分对游戏开发者也有一定的参考价值。

总结

《Java编程思想》不仅仅是一本教材,更是一本指导思想的书。它通过系统的讲解和丰富的示例,帮助读者从基础到高级逐步掌握Java编程的精髓。无论你是初学者还是经验丰富的开发者,这本书都能提供新的视角和深入的理解。通过阅读和实践,你将能够更好地应用Java进行各种应用开发,提升编程能力和解决问题的能力。

希望这篇《Java编程思想读书报告》能为你提供有价值的信息,激发你对Java编程的兴趣和热情。